Tee Ball (ages 4-6) – The Tee Ball division is for players who want to learn the fundamentals of hitting and fielding. The focus is on instruction rather than competition. Rules of the game may be varied to accommodate the need for teaching. The primary goals of Tee Ball are to instruct children in the fundamentals of baseball and to allow them to experience the value of teamwork. Coaches are permitted on the field to teach while the game is in progress. Players hit a ball off a batting tee stand. Players have the opportunity to try all positions. Fee $30 per player
